What You’ll Do

The Site Selection Manager partners closely with Capacity Planning, Program Management, Engineering, Finance, Legal, and external partners to maintain a disciplined, data-driven pipeline that aligns with Core Weave’s technical, commercial, and time-to-market objectives.

Americas Site Identification & Evaluation
  • Identify, evaluate, and advance data center opportunities across the U.S. and the Americas markets. Support the development of the metro strategy by assessing power availability, scalability, costs, permitting, tax incentives, and regional risk.
  • Coordinate early technical and commercial feasibility reviews with internal stakeholders.
Due Diligence & Deal Advancement
  • Lead site-level due diligence including power and utility capacity, substation access, utility timelines, fiber availability, zoning, permitting, environmental considerations, and constructability.
  • Gather, review, and validate inputs from landlords, utilities, brokers, consultants, and municipalities.
  • Ensure diligence findings are clearly documented and communicated to leadership.
Lease & Transaction Support
  • Support lease negotiations and commercial structuring in partnership with Real Estate and Legal.
  • Track deal progression, milestones, and deliverables from LOI through execution.
  • Assist with preparing deal review materials, executive summaries, and approval packages.
Pipeline & Documentation Management
  • Maintain accurate site records, documentation, and status updates in Salesforce and internal tracking systems.
  • Monitor deal health, proactively flag risks or delays, and ensure data integrity across the Americas pipeline.
  • Coordinate closely with Transaction Analysts, Program Managers, and Site Diligence teams.
Cross-Functional Coordination
  • Serve as the primary site-level point of coordination across Engineering, Capacity Planning, Networking, Finance, Legal, and Operations.
  • Support clean handoff from site selection into delivery, buildout, and operations phases.
  • Ensure alignment between technical requirements, commercial commitments, and delivery timelines.
External Partner Engagement
  • Manage relationships with brokers, landlords, utilities, consultants, and development partners across U.S. and Americas markets.
  • Evaluate inbound site opportunities and ensure consistent screening against Core Weave standards.
